Job Summary:

As a Sterile Processing Aide, you will handle daily workflow tasks as a vital part of the Sterile Processing Team. By managing routine tasks, you help increase productivity and efficiency in the department.  

You will empty instruments and cart washers. This includes scanning tray tags in the instrument tracking system, placing trays in the Drying Cabinet, and moving trays to staging areas for assembly. You will also move carts to the staging area, empty container tracks, sort, and store containers for easy access. 

As an aide, you will deliver and pick up instruments and case carts from the Labor, Delivery, Recovery, Postpartum department and additional departments like the Breast Care Center and Interventional Radiology.

ProMedica is a mission-driven, not-for-profit health care organization headquartered in Toledo, Ohio. It serves communities across nine states and provides a range of services, including acute and ambulatory care, a dental plan, and academic business lines. ProMedica owns and operates 10 hospitals and has an affiliated interest in one additional hospital. The organization employs over 1,300 health care providers through ProMedica Physicians and has more than 2,300 physicians and advanced practice providers with privileges. Committed to its mission of improving health and well-being, ProMedica has received national recognition for its clinical excellence and its initiatives to address social determinants of health. For more information about ProMedica, please visit promedica.org/aboutus.
